Within Our Gates

One thing I really liked about this movie was the fact that the biggest heroes were women. Sylvia obviously was the star of the movie, and accomplishes so much. She's comes back from all the traumatic events of her younger life to be this strong amazing woman who goes out and gets money for the school. Any of the men in the school could have gone, but it was her who was the strongest, and wouldn't take no for an answer until she raised the money for the school. Then, the person who ends up donating all the money is a woman as well. This is great because at this time, women, especially African American women had almost no power. The women characters in this movie were great role models for women at this time, showing them that they could accomplish what they dreamed of and that they can change the world for the better.
